I am just curious here. Over the past year this site has seemed to take on a different personality.

What was once a friendly welcoming place where people came together from all over to share some laughs and their passion for life seems to now be filled with hostile, condescending and argumentative people.

Sangiro created a great place for us to come together. When this place was really getting started and Rec was still around, the Rec trolls would refer to this as the place for Shiny Happy People. For some of us, that was breath of fresh air. A Place where people were actually friendly towards each other. People came from all over for gatherings like the 02 Holiday Boogie, The DZ.com tent at Rantoul was packed with people for a year or two, the first few Dublin Boogies where 100`s showed up. Every weekend it seemed we were traveling somewhere to meet up others that we first met on this site.

There was very much a since of community that seems to be fading here. It reads more like REC every day. I think it goes beyond the graphic posts that Sangiro has already addressed. the tone and atmosphere seem to have changed. There is a very different tone here. Some of the more prominent posters now seem to be quick to see how rude they can be without crossing the PA line. Their objectives seem to me to be to establish themselves by putting others down.


What happened?
Am I the only one that is seeing this?

Why is it happening?
Inevitable Growth and change?
Losing so many of our core personalities like Holly, GFD, Deuce, Skinny and others?
We all finally got to know each other and realized we didn’t like each other after all?
Just plain time for Change?
I am just getting old and everthing always seems like it used to be better?

I still love this site and the people I met through it and the great experiences I have had over the past 6 years thanks to this site. I just hate to see what was once a warm welcoming place changing into a REC like hostile environment. What are your thoughts?
